Call of Duty: Warzone and Modern Warfare loading screens replaced with Black Lives Matter splash

Anyone who jumps into Call of Duty: Warzone and Modern Warfare will be greeted with new splash screens advocating for Black Lives Matter.

Infinity Ward rolled out a small update last night for Call of Duty: Warzone and Modern Warfare that changed the game's splash and loading screens to a black screen titled, "Black Lives Matter."

It goes on to relay a message of support to the Black community and everyone's fight against racism and inequality. It is hard to miss.

"The systemic inequalities our community experiences are once again center stage. Call of Duty and Infinity Ward stand for equality and inclusion. We stand against the racism and injustice our Black community endures. Until change happens and Black Lives Matter, we will never truly be the community we strive to be," it reads.

This comes after both Modern Warfare and Call of Duty: Mobile delayed their new season launches. Earlier this week, Infinity Ward made a commitment to eradicate racist user content in its games by ramping up moderation efforts and working on new reporting tools.
